What is Preventive Dental Care?
Preventative dental care is a proactive approach to looking after your teeth and gums. Instead of waiting for pain or problems to appear, preventive dentistry focuses on regular care and early detection to keep your oral health in great condition.
That includes:
- Professional cleans and polishing
- Fluoride treatments
- Dental check-ups
- Digital x-rays
- Personalised oral hygiene routines
- Product advice
- Monitoring for early signs of decay or gum disease
This kind of care can make all the difference in keeping your mouth healthy and avoiding more complex treatments down the track.

- Dental Hygiene Appointments
Our hygiene team provides professional cleaning to remove plaque and tartar, reduce gum inflammation, and protect your teeth from decay. They’ll also chat with you about brushing techniques, flossing tips, and any areas that need special care.
- Fluoride Treatments
Fluoride strengthens your enamel and helps prevent cavities. It’s a simple and effective part of any preventive dentistry routine.
- Carifree System
If you’re experiencing frequent decay, you might benefit from CariFree, a scientifically proven decay prevention system that changes the chemical balance of your mouth to reduce harmful bacteria.
With a quick, painless test, we can check your bacterial levels and recommend the right CariFree products for at-home use.

Preventive dental care is for everyone, not just those who’ve had dental issues in the past. Whether you’re young, older, have a mouth full of fillings or none at all, prevention plays a big role in keeping your smile healthy.
- Children: Learning proper brushing and flossing habits early on helps prevent cavities and builds confidence at the dentist.
- Adults: Routine check-ups can help catch gum disease or decay early, before it becomes more complex (and expensive) to treat.
- Seniors: As we age, oral health needs change. Preventive care supports strong teeth and gums, and can help manage dry mouth or gum recession.
